23rd April 2019, Morning Brief

Market will open on a flat note today after tumbling session yesterday.

A rise in crude oil was one of the top factors that not only weighed on Indian markets but most of the Asian markets. Oil prices that touched a 5-month peak spiked on reports that the US was likely to ask all importers of Iranian oil to end their purchases or face sanctions.

U.S. equity indices closed mix in light volume as investors prepared for a deluge of earnings news. Oil jumped after the White House said it will scrap waivers that allow the purchase of some Iranian crude.

Reuters in a report said that Brent futures rallied to a five-month high after the Washington Post.

Nifty has an immediate support at 11550. If Nifty decisively closes below 11550 then it can be considered as exhaustion after making new high and it will stay rangebound or may slide upto the levels of 11050 & 11180.

🎯 Essel Propack :
Blackstone Group will buy a controlling stake in Essel Propack Ltd., a company promoted by Ashok Goel, the younger brother of Subhash Chandra who’s the promoter of the Essel Group companies such as Zee Entertainment Enterprises Ltd.

🎯 IL&FS / GAIL :
Gail emerged as the highest bidder for IL&FS wind energy assets, offers Rs. 4,800 crore portfolio of wind assets.

🎯 Mcleod Russel :
Company executed sale agreement for specified assets from its three estates to Luxmi Tea for Rs.150.45 crore.
